On The Absence of A Mother
Installation 23x73x2in.
Mixed Media materials joined into a carved wooden frame, this piece is an acknowledgement of a prior version of myself. A little girl that waited years for her mother to return until she became a mother herself. In Korean, the word “Fantasy” displayed on both sides speaks to a childhood of utilizing games, make-believe stories and maintaining the secret of motherlessness to pacify what was a quiet shame.
